London Weather in November

November marks the beginning of winter in London, and you can definitely feel it in the air. The average temperature ranges from 5°C (41°F) to 11°C (52°F). However, it’s important to note that London weather can be quite unpredictable, so don’t be surprised if you encounter colder or milder days.

Pack Accordingly

When packing for your trip to London in November, it is wise to layer your clothing. This way, you can easily adjust your outfit according to the changing temperatures throughout the day. Don’t forget to pack a warm coat, scarves, gloves, and a hat to keep yourself cozy while exploring the city.

Winter Wonderland

If you’re visiting towards the end of November or early December, don’t miss out on London’s Winter Wonderland in Hyde Park. This annual event features ice skating, festive markets, thrilling rides, and delicious food and drinks. It’s a magical experience that truly embraces the holiday spirit.

  • Fun fact: November 5th is Bonfire Night in London, commemorating Guy Fawkes’ failed attempt to blow up the Houses of Parliament in 1605. The city comes alive with spectacular firework displays!
